MS Dhoni, the veteran India cricketer, is in the fag end of his career, and sooner or later, he would announce his retirement from limited-overs cricket. So who is there to replace him right away? The list includes a few players, but Rishabh Pant’s name sits at the top position. Though Dinesh Karthik would remain in line to fill Dhoni’s shoes in the team; the selectors seemed high on the young prodigy. Meanwhile, Rishabh Pant has issued a warning to his idol ahead of the IPL 2019.

It’s time to show him (MS) my game – Pant

As all the eight franchises gear up for the twelfth edition of the Indian Premier League, the Delhi Capitals appeared to take a step ahead. In a video released by the franchise on their Twitter handle, their star batsman, Rishabh Pant is seen giving a gentle warning to MS Dhoni to be wary of his game. Though he had mentioned earlier, MS happens to be his idol, and had he not been there, Pant wouldn’t have picked keeping gloves.

However, he further added the time has come for Dhoni to make a note of Pant’s explosive cricket. Rishabh Pant tweeted,

CSK to start as favourites in IPL 2019

The history says there a contrasting script for everyone to read when it comes to Chennai Super Kings and Delhi Capitals in the IPL. Though Delhi had never won an IPL in eleven years, MS Dhoni-led CSK had been crowned champions for joint-record three times. Even in the past season, they clinched gold – beating Sunrisers Hyderabad by eight wickets in the finale.

As far as personal performances were concerned, Pant was the second highest run-scorer in the tournament; hitting 684 runs in 14 matches at a strike rate of 173.60. MS Dhoni, on the other hand, scored 455 runs in 16 games, having a strike rate of 150 plus.
